数据结构

出圈算法

题目:有 people 个人站成一个圈,第一个人开始数数(从1开始),每数到 num 或者 num 的倍数此人就退出。最后剩下的人是多少号?网上看了看,应该有很多种实现方法,在此摘录下来。 方式一:1234567static int cycle(int people, int num) { int i, r = 0; for (i = 2; i <= people; i++) { r = (r + num)...